Output 63b16c02c0ec3d4724d68467037b9a43da191622c7663c7fc4bbaae96319ed8e:41

value
43915185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f996be98973e022ddcee4c092202539dc1d4ab0 OP_EQUAL
address
34a6fQU9RuYStMdvie7kPCUpXJFAKZM424
transaction
63b16c02c0ec3d4724d68467037b9a43da191622c7663c7fc4bbaae96319ed8e
spent
true